相关文章
【JavaScript】原型链/作用域/this指针/闭包
1.原型链
参考资料:Annotated ES5
ECMAScript起初并不支持如C、Smalltalk 或 Java 中“类”的形式创建对象,而是通过字面量表示法或者构造函数创建对象。每个构造函数都是一个具有名为“prototype”的属性的函数,该属性用于实现基于原型的继…
编程日记
2024/11/20 20:29:29
Mac安装Docker提示Another application changed your Desktop configuration解决方案
1. 问题描述
Mac安装Docker后,提示Another application changed your Desktop configuration,Re-apply configurations无效 2. 解决方案
在终端执行下述命令即可解决:
sudo ln -sf /Applications/Docker.app/Contents/Resources/bin/docke…
编程日记
2024/12/21 13:00:52
自动化脚本代码appium+pytest+adb
pytest多线程与多设备并发appium
使用adb获取应用的内存和CPU使用情况
import pytest
import subprocess# 测试用例:检查应用的内存使用情况
def test_memory_usage():package_name com.example.myappmemory_info subprocess.check_output([adb, …
编程日记
2024/12/16 3:11:50
Java IO流File类
1.文件基本操作
package com.jsu;import java.io.File;
import java.io.IOException;public class Demo001 {public static void main(String[] args) {File file1 new File("D:\\temp.txt");//创建文件对象if(file1.exists()){System.out.println("文件名&qu…
编程日记
2024/12/19 10:22:31
如何在 Node.js 中使用 bcrypt 对密码进行哈希处理
在网页开发领域中,安全性至关重要,特别是涉及到用户凭据如密码时。在网页开发中至关重要的一个安全程序是密码哈希处理。
密码哈希处理确保明文密码在数据库受到攻击时也难以被攻击者找到。但并非所有的哈希方法都是一样的,这就是 bcrypt 突…
编程日记
2024/12/17 2:35:36
腾讯云4核8G服务器12M带宽646元1年零3个月,4C8G使用场景说明
腾讯云4核8G服务器多少钱?腾讯云4核8G轻量应用服务器12M带宽租用价格646元15个月,活动页面 txybk.com/go/txy 活动链接打开如下图所示: 腾讯云4核8G服务器优惠价格 这台4核8G服务器是轻量应用服务器,详细配置为:轻量4核…
编程日记
2024/12/19 12:06:35
网络与并发编程(一)
并发编程介绍_串行_并行_并发的区别
串行、并行与并发的区别
串行(serial):一个CPU上,按顺序完成多个任务并行(parallelism):指的是任务数小于等于cpu核数,即任务真的是一起执行的并发(concurrency):一个CPU采用时间…
编程日记
2024/12/15 7:58:57
后端上传文件使用阿里云oss存储文件(图片)
1,pom.xml安装依赖 <dependency><groupId>com.aliyun.oss</groupId><artifactId>aliyun-sdk-oss</artifactId><version>3.10.2</version></dependency>
2,application.yml配置
aliyun:oss:file:# oss…
编程日记
2024/12/16 8:50:34